Initially the Internet was built on the notion that any computer on a global network can be identified by its numeric Internet Protocol (
IP) address. But since people, are the primary users of the Internet, a more people-friendly naming system called the Domain Name System (
DNS) was invented This System translates a domain name such as 1stDomain.net into Internet Protocol (
IP) numbers to find the correct web site - in this case the site for 1stDomain.net. The data is then made available to all computers and users on the Internet.
